12. a trader gained 15% by selling an
article for N1560.00, what is the cost
price of the article?​

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 04-08-2020

Answer:

N1356

Step-by-step explanation: I hope it helps :)

[tex]Profit \% = 15\%\\Selling -Price = N1560.00\\C.P = ?\\\\CP = ( SP \times 100 ) / ( 100 + percentage \: profit).\\C.P =\frac{Selling \:price \times 100}{100+ Profit \%} \\\\C.P = \frac{1560\times 100}{100+15} \\\\C .P = \frac{156000}{115} \\\\C.P =N1356.5[/tex]
